Industrial exports was 4% up in April-July
In April-July 2005 Industrial exports, excluding diamonds, grew 4% to $8.5 billion. The Manufacturers Association noted, however, that 4% growth in industrial exports was recorded after falling 1.5% in the first quarter

H1 : Israel’s exports to Arab countries up 21%
In January-June 2005 Israel’s industrial exports to Arab countries, excluding diamonds, grew 21% to $106 million, compared with the corresponding period in 2004

Shippers fury on Ashdod's congestion surcharge
Mr. Gad Sheffer Chairman of the Israeli Shippers' Council slammed last week the shipping companies arguing that due to the recent service improvement at the port of Ashdod, there was no justification to charge 7% congestion surcharge

Bank of Israel : State of the Economy index up 0.1% in July
The Bank of Israel announced last week that the State of the Economy index rose 0.1% in July, after remaining unchanged in June

CBS: industrial production in first half, up annual 4.7%
The Central Bureau of Statistics ( CBS ) reported last week that industrial output in the first half of 2005 grew by a seasonally adjusted annualized 4.7%, compared with the first half of 2004

Ministry of finance plans to abolish Eilat port special status
Finance Ministry officials said last week that the Ministry was studying the possibility to abolish several tariff inducements given to cargo moving through the port of Eilat
